一、引言
随着物联网技术的飞速发展,智能设备种类日益繁多,从智能手机、平板电脑到智能电视、智能家居设备,用户在不同场景下使用不同设备的需求愈发强烈。因此,物联网多端UI适配设计中心应运而生,成为连接用户与设备之间无缝体验的重要桥梁。
二、物联网多端UI适配设计中心概述
物联网多端UI适配设计中心是一个集设计、开发、测试于一体的综合性平台,旨在解决物联网设备间界面不一致、操作体验差异大等问题。通过该平台,设计师和开发者可以针对不同设备特性进行定制化设计,确保用户在不同设备上都能获得一致且优质的体验。
三、设计原则与挑战
-
响应式设计:响应式设计是物联网多端UI适配的基础。它要求界面能够根据不同设备的屏幕尺寸、分辨率等自动调整布局和元素大小,以适应各种屏幕尺寸。然而,物联网设备的多样性给响应式设计带来了巨大挑战。
-
跨平台兼容性:物联网设备运行在不同的操作系统上,如Android、iOS、Windows等。因此,UI设计需要考虑到不同操作系统的界面风格和交互习惯,确保界面在不同平台上都能保持良好的兼容性。
-
设备特性利用:不同物联网设备具有不同的特性和功能,如触摸屏、语音控制、摄像头等。UI设计应充分利用这些特性,提供更加丰富、便捷的交互方式。
四、解决方案与技术实践
-
自适应布局技术:采用CSS Grid、Flexbox等自适应布局技术,实现界面元素的灵活排列和自动调整。这些技术能够根据不同设备的屏幕尺寸和分辨率自动调整布局,确保界面在不同设备上都能保持良好的视觉效果。
-
组件化设计:将常用的界面元素封装为组件,实现组件的复用和快速迭代。组件化设计不仅可以提高开发效率,还可以确保界面在不同设备上的一致性。
-
智能化适配工具:利用AI技术实现智能化的UI适配。通过训练模型,让AI自动识别设备特性并生成相应的UI设计。这种智能化的适配方式可以大大提高适配效率和准确性。
五、未来趋势与展望
-
更加智能化的适配:随着AI技术的不断发展,物联网多端UI适配将变得更加智能化。未来的适配工具将能够自动识别设备特性、用户习惯等因素,并生成更加个性化的UI设计。
-
跨平台开发框架的普及:跨平台开发框架如Flutter、React Native等将越来越普及。这些框架允许开发者使用一套代码同时开发Android和iOS应用,大大降低了开发成本和时间。未来,这些框架也将进一步扩展到物联网领域,实现跨平台、跨设备的UI开发。
-
更加注重用户体验:物联网多端UI设计将更加注重用户体验。设计师和开发者需要深入了解用户需求和使用场景,提供符合用户期望的交互方式和界面设计。同时,还需要关注无障碍设计、隐私保护等方面的问题,确保用户在使用过程中的舒适度和安全性。
六、结语
物联网多端UI适配设计中心是实现跨平台、跨设备一致用户体验的关键。通过遵循响应式设计原则、利用自适应布局技术、组件化设计以及智能化适配工具等方法,我们可以有效应对物联网设备多样性带来的挑战。未来,随着技术的不断发展,物联网多端UI设计将更加智能化、个性化和注重用户体验。